Matka Canyon: Water, Mountains, and Mystique

A major highlight is the trip to Matka Canyon, about 30 km from Skopje. The guided tour here includes a boat cruise that lasts around 1.5 hours, taking you across the serene waters of Lake Treska. Along the way, you’ll marvel at the rugged cliffs and lush greenery that surround the canyon. The boat ride is particularly relaxing and offers a chance to enjoy the scenery from the water, with some reviewers praising the peaceful vibe.

During the visit, you’ll walk along the riverbank to reach the Monastery of St. Andrew, which adds a historical dimension to the natural beauty. The cave, Vrelo, is a must-see stop—filled with impressive stalactites and stalagmites, along with two small lakes. Exploring Skopje’s Historic Old Town

After returning to the city, the tour shifts to the historic core. You’ll walk through Kale Fortress, the ancient citadel offering panoramic city views and a glimpse into Skopje’s Ottoman past. The guide offers detailed insights into the fortress’s history, making it more than just a photo stop.

Next, a visit to Mustafa Pasha Mosque provides a look into the city’s Islamic heritage. The stroll through the Old Bazaar is a highlight, with its centuries-old caravanserais and Turkish baths dating back to the 15th century. This part of the tour feels like stepping back in time and gives you ample opportunities to explore and take photos.

Modern Skopje and Mother Teresa’s Memorial

After lunch, the tour moves to the modern part of Skopje. Crossing the Stone Bridge—a symbol of the city—you’ll see numerous statues and monuments that dot the cityscape, blending history with contemporary art. The tour concludes at the Memorial House of Mother Teresa, a fitting tribute to one of the world’s most beloved humanitarian figures, and a reminder of Skopje’s diverse cultural fabric.
